Q1 2025

EXECUTIVE SUMMARY

The first quarter of 2025 closed with 368.4 million domain name registrations across all top-level domains (TLDs), an increase of 4.2 million domain name registrations, or 1.1% compared to the fourth quarter of 2024. Domain name registrations increased by 6.1 million, or 1.7%, year over year.

The .com and .net TLDs had a combined total of 169.8 million domain name registrations in the domain name base at the end of the first quarter of 2025, an increase of 0.8 million domain name registrations, or 0.5% compared to the fourth quarter of 2024. The .com and .net TLDs had a combined decrease of 2.6 million domain name registrations, or 1.5%, year over year. As of March 31, 2025, the .com domain name base totaled 157.2 million domain name registrations and the .net domain name base totaled 12.6 million domain name registrations. New .com and .net domain name registrations totaled 10.1 million at the end of the first quarter of 2025, compared to 9.5 million domain name registrations at the end of the first quarter of 2024. The preliminary combined renewal percentage for the .com and .net TLDs is 75.3% for the first quarter of 2025.

Total country-code TLD (ccTLD) domain name registrations were 142.9 million at the end of the first quarter of 2025, an increase of 2.1 million domain name registrations, or 1.5% compared to the fourth quarter of 2024. ccTLDs increased by 3.4 million domain name registrations, or 2.4%, year over year. Available data is insufficient to estimate a combined quarterly renewal percentage across ccTLDs.

Total new generic TLD (ngTLD) domain name registrations were 37.8 million at the end of the first quarter of 2025, an increase of 1.0 million domain name registrations, or 2.6%, compared to the fourth quarter of 2024. ngTLDs increased by 4.5 million domain name registrations, or 13.5%, year over year. The most recent combined renewal percentage estimate for ngTLDs was 34.2%.

Total other legacy generic TLD (gTLD) domain name registrations, not including .com and .net, were 17.9 million at the end of the first quarter of 2025, an increase of 0.4 million domain name registrations, or 2.0%, compared to the fourth quarter of 2024. Other legacy gTLDs increased by 850.6 thousand domain name registrations, or 5.0%, year over year. The most recent combined renewal percentage estimate for other legacy gTLDs was 74.3%.

Top 10 Largest TLDs by Number of Reported Domain Names

As of March 31, 2025, the 10 largest TLDs by number of reported domain names were .com, .cn, .de, .net, .org, .uk, .ru, .nl, .br and .au. For the top 10 TLDs with available data, recent quarterly renewal percentage estimates ranged from 81.4% for .org to 68.3% for .ru.

Top 10 Largest ccTLDs by Number of Reported Domain Names

The top 10 ccTLDs, as of March 31, 2025, were .cn, .de, .uk, .ru, .nl, .br, .au, .fr, .in and .eu. As of March 31, 2025, there were 316 global ccTLD extensions delegated in the root zone, including internationalized domain names, with the top 10 ccTLDs comprising 58.3% of all ccTLD domain name registrations. For the top 10 ccTLDs with available data, recent quarterly renewal percentage estimates ranged from 83.4% for .fr to 68.3% for .ru.

Top 10 Largest gTLDs by Number of Reported Domain Names

The top 10 gTLDs, as of March 31, 2025, were .com, .net, .org, .xyz, .info, .shop, .top, .online, .store and .site. As of March 31, 2025, there were 1,264 extensions delegated in the root zone, including IDNs, with the top 10 gTLDs comprising 89.5% of all gTLD domain name registrations and 54.8% of all TLD registrations. New gTLDs collectively accounted for 10.3% of all TLD registrations as of March 31, 2025. For the top 10 gTLDs, recent quarterly renewal percentage estimates ranged from 81.4% for .org to 13.4% for .shop.
